HIGH PERFORMANCE FLUTE DESIGN • efficiently transports chips • increases strength for aggressive drilling Ti-NAMITE A COATING • improves resistance to heat and wear • enhances tool life DOUBLE MARGIN DESIGN • improves accuracy and surface finish B2 • increases stability and rigidity The key features designed into the SGS Hi-PerCarb drill allow the product to offer application benefits not only beyond that of standard carbide drills, but also other High Performance drills. Each feature of the SGS Hi-PerCarb drill was uniquely engineered as a solution towards addressing the issues commonly...

PRECISION. The stability of the double margin design and penetration capability of the point geometry allow the Hi-PerCarb drill to address demanding applications that would normally require reduced operating parameters or a two step process. PASSION. The secondary flute provides a channel for cooling capabilities normally not found in external coolant drills, this combined with the Ti-NAMITE A tool coating and the high strength edge design results in increased operating parameters with additional tool life.
